Senior Group National Rowing Championship from February 22 in Pune
With eight months left for the Hangzhou Asian Games this year, the 40th National Rowing Championships of the senior group will be held in Pune from February 22. The event will be held on the Army College of Engineering (CME) track and more than 500 athletes will participate.
This is the only rowing center in the country with international standard facilities, where competitors from 25 states are ready to showcase their skills. Arjunlal Jat and Arvind Singh will be India’s main attraction at the Tokyo 2020 Olympics. This was India’s first pair to reach the semi-finals in an Olympic event. After that, the same pair won the gold medal in the Asian Championship in Thailand last year. The national competition will be held over 2000m and 500m for men and women respectively.
The events for the men’s category include single sculls, double sculls, coxless doubles, coxless fours, (all in 2000m and 500m). Open double sculls and coxless fours and coxed eight will be held in 2000m only. Women’s single sculls, double sculls, coxless doubles, coxless fours (2000m, 500m), double sculls event (500m) and para men’s single sculls (200m, 500m) will also be held.
CME will be hosting the national championship for the fourth time on the track that was built in 2009. First national competition was held in 2014. After that, the 37th tournament was organized in 2018 and the 39th tournament in 2019.
